Specifications of EP1C3T100I7N

Number Of Logic Elements/cells2910Number Of Labs/clbs291
Total Ram Bits59904Number Of I /o65
Voltage - Supply1.425 V ~ 1.575 VMounting TypeSurface Mount
Operating Temperature-40°C ~ 100°CPackage / Case100-TQFP, 100-VQFP
Family NameCyclone®Number Of Logic Blocks/elements2910
# I/os (max)65Frequency (max)320.1MHz
Process Technology0.13um (CMOS)Operating Supply Voltage (typ)1.5V
Logic Cells2910Ram Bits59904
Operating Supply Voltage (min)1.425VOperating Supply Voltage (max)1.575V
Operating Temp Range-40C to 100COperating Temperature ClassificationIndustrial
MountingSurface MountPin Count100
Package TypeTQFPLead Free Status / RoHS StatusLead free / RoHS Compliant

Each I/O bank has its own VCCIO pins. A single device can support 1.5-V,
1.8-V, 2.5-V, and 3.3-V interfaces; each individual bank can support a
different standard with different I/O voltages. Each bank also has
dual-purpose VREF pins to support any one of the voltage-referenced
standards (e.g., SSTL-3) independently. If an I/O bank does not use
voltage-referenced standards, the V
